I’m more into boxing bets myself, and it’s the same deal: skip the chaos, focus on the grind. Dig into fighters’ records, not just their last bout—check their stamina, how they handle southpaws, or if they crumble late rounds. Sites like BoxRec give you the raw stats, no fluff. Bet small on early fights, save the big swings for when you’ve got a read on form. Chasing the knockout vibe? That’s a quick way to burn out. Stick to the plan, keep stakes tight, and don’t let the thrill mess with your head. Works for horses, arrows, or fists.
